Description

Human actions are determined by their external and internal needs. Albert Einstein is known for his theory of relativity and his remarkable contributions to theoretical physics. He was awarded the Nobel Prize in Physics in 1921. His writings and research on quantum theory, wormholes, and thermodynamics still inspire curiosity in the minds of budding scientists.The World as I See It (1934), written in the wake of World War I and Hitlers rise to power, finds Einstein striving for a peaceful world amidst the turmoil of balancing his life.In this book, Einstein, through numerous letters, articles, and interviews, reveals his insights into important topics within Jewish society, including education, morality, politics, science, and religion, making him popular with countless readers.
